A Birthday in Iran, 1973
It could be difficult to conceive at present, but Iran had relatively liberal social norms in the past. This photo, taken in 1974, depicts a woman wearing whatever she pleased, which was acceptable at that time. Additionally, religion had a lesser impact on legislation in comparison to its current influence. Of course, the revolution happened in response to the corruption of the shah, and everything took a turn for the more conservative.
However, photos of women dressed in Western-style clothing like this were common before the revolution. Presumably, this woman celebrated her birthday at her residence in Tehran, and there were likely guests in attendance as she blew out the candles on her cake.
